A19 TWC is a 2003 Ford Galaxy in Red with a 1,896c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 18 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 72.2%.
Across all 2003 Ford Galaxy models, the average MOT pass rate is 68.6% with a typical mileage of 96,357 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a Ford Galaxy f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 102,272 recorded failures. If you're considering buying A19 TWC,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Ford Galaxy typically stays on UK roads for around 31 years. At 23 years old, this Ford Galaxy is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
